When I first started trading, my strategy was purely based on emotions and random indicators. I’d chase breakouts without confirmation and exit trades too early or too late. Over time, I realized the importance of structure — setting clear entry/exit rules, managing risk properly, and backtesting every idea. Now, my strategy is more disciplined, data-driven, and aligned with market conditions. It's not about being right every time, but about being consistent and protecting capital. This evolution didn’t happen overnight, but each mistake shaped a smarter, more refined approach.
